Army 1 Fairfield 0

The Fairfield Stags women's soccer team (4-4) were shutout by the Army Black Knights (7-2) this afternoon. The Stags are now 1-3 in home games this year. Click for a complete recap and boxscore.

The Least You Should Know:

-Fairfield has been shutout 3 straight games at home.

-Army is ranked 7th in the NSCAA Mid Atlantic Region

-The Black Knights have only allowed 3 goals all year.

I liked what I saw out of the team in the second half. They came out aggressive and really had Army on its heels and almost tied up the game but Jasmin Corniel's shot was saved by a diving Alex Lostetter to keep the lead. I am a little worried about the Stag's offense and how can you not be. They haven't scored a goal at home for over 300 minutes and have been shutout in three of their last 4 games. O'Brien says it's because they don't play a full game and I agree. They are 0-4 when trailing this season but undefeated when they score the first goal.
